If so, this is a great opportunity to put your faith to work and make a real difference.The Church of Scotland’s World Mission Council works with communities in Israel and Palestine supporting the local Christian population through our Churches, hotel, guesthouse and school. The following role is crucial to the continued success of our work.
Regional Manager
c. £37,500
You will be responsible for the effective management of our commercial centres, with an anticipated turnover of £3.3 million in 2008. Maintaining the financial and management integrity of the Church’s work in the region, you will ensure that the school, guesthouse and hotel achieve
their purpose within the region’s wider ministry work.We are looking for considerable business experience including proven financial, management and organisational skills.
The salary for this post is normally tax-free while overseas and accommodation, insurance and a car are provided. For this post you must be a committed Christian in good standing with your Church. This is a Genuine Occupational Requirement in terms of the Employment Equality (Religion or Belief) Regulations 2003. This post is subject to Enhanced Disclosure checks.
